Job description

As a Smart Home Specialist, you will be responsible for troubleshooting and providing technical support for our electromechanical systems. You'll also be expected to understand the basics of home networking, IoT devices, and home automation systems. Your expertise will extend to training our window dealers, addressing customer inquiries, collaborating with internal teams, and contributing to the improvement of our products and services.

Highlights of your role

  • Electromechanical Troubleshooting: Diagnose and resolve technical issues related to the low voltage electromechanical systems controlling our windows and doors. Serve as the go-to expert for complex technical challenges.
  • Smart Home Integration: Understand the fundamentals of home networking, IoT devices, and home automation systems. Work closely with Smart Home integrators to grasp the intricacies of programming and integrating internet-connected devices into large-scale automation systems like Control4 or Crestron Home.
  • Product Expertise: Develop an in-depth understanding of the electromechanical systems utilized in our products. Train our window dealers to ensure their proficiency in handling and troubleshooting these systems.
  • Customer Interaction: Engage directly with homeowners who are encountering technical issues with our products. Provide remote support via phone or email, guiding them through troubleshooting steps to effectively resolve issues.
  • On-Site Support: Travel to customer locations when required to address and rectify electromechanical system problems that cannot be resolved remotely.
  • Collaboration with Sales Teams: Collaborate with our internal sales force to provide technical insights and assistance during the sales process, ensuring accurate communication of product capabilities and benefits to potential customers.
  • Research and Development: Work closely with the research and development team to communicate field-based issues and suggest improvements. Contribute to the enhancement of product reliability and performance.
  • Internal Training: Develop and conduct training programs for our internal customer service teams. Empower them to independently address simpler customer issues, enhancing overall customer satisfaction.

 

You're a good fit if you have

  • Proficiency in troubleshooting electromechanical systems, preferably in a similar industry.
  • Basic understanding of home networking, IoT devices, and Smart Home automation.
  • Familiarity with Control4, Crestron Home, or similar automation systems is advantageous.
  • Strong communication skills for effectively interacting with various stakeholders, both technical and non-technical.
  • Ability to travel to customer sites as needed.
  • Previous experience in technical training and customer support roles is a plus.
